Why St. Maarten's Airport is Unique and Challenging

Let's talk a bit about St. Maarten's airport itself, guys. It's not your average airport; it's famous – or perhaps infamous – for its unique location and challenging landing conditions. Princess Juliana International Airport (SXM) sits right next to Maho Beach, which means planes have to make a very low approach over the beach before touching down on the short runway. Can you picture that? Imagine sunbathing on the beach and seeing a massive jetliner practically skimming overhead! This close proximity is a huge draw for plane spotters and tourists looking for a thrill, but it also presents significant challenges for pilots. The short runway length means pilots have less room to decelerate after landing, requiring them to brake firmly and sometimes even use reverse thrust to stop in time. The approach to the runway is also tricky. Aircraft must descend steeply over the water and beach, making precise altitude control crucial. Add to that the unpredictable Caribbean winds, and you have a recipe for potentially rough landing conditions. Wind shear, sudden changes in wind speed and direction, can be particularly problematic, especially during the final stages of landing. These factors can cause an aircraft to lose lift or deviate from its intended path, requiring pilots to make quick adjustments. While the airport has a strong safety record, the unique conditions mean that pilots must be highly skilled and well-trained to handle the challenges. Procedures are in place to mitigate risks, including strict operating procedures, advanced weather monitoring systems, and highly qualified air traffic controllers. However, even with these precautions, the inherent challenges of the airport mean that landings can sometimes be less smooth than at other airports. The Aftermath and Investigation

So, what happens after a rough landing like the one experienced by the WestJet flight in St. Maarten? Well, the immediate aftermath involves a series of crucial steps to ensure the safety of passengers and the thorough investigation of the incident. First and foremost, the priority is the well-being of everyone on board. Once the aircraft is safely on the ground, the flight crew will assess the situation and ensure that there are no injuries requiring immediate medical attention. Passengers may be asked to remain seated while the crew conducts a quick inspection of the cabin and the aircraft's exterior. This allows them to identify any potential damage or hazards. Depending on the severity of the rough landing, emergency services, such as airport fire and rescue teams, may be called to the scene as a precautionary measure. They can provide additional support and medical assistance if needed. The next crucial step is the investigation. Aviation incidents, even seemingly minor ones, are thoroughly investigated by regulatory agencies, such as the Transportation Safety Board (TSB) in Canada or the National Transportation Safety Board (NTSB) in the United States. These investigations aim to determine the cause of the incident and prevent similar occurrences in the future. Investigators will gather a wide range of information, including flight data recorder information (the "black box"), weather reports, maintenance records, and interviews with the flight crew, air traffic controllers, and passengers. They will analyze this data to identify any contributing factors, such as mechanical issues, weather conditions, human error, or procedural shortcomings. The investigation can take weeks or even months to complete, depending on the complexity of the incident. Once the investigation is concluded, the regulatory agency will issue a report with its findings and recommendations. These recommendations may include changes to aircraft maintenance procedures, pilot training, air traffic control protocols, or airport safety regulations. The goal is to learn from every incident and continuously improve aviation safety.
